The Angel's Game opens in Barcelona in the 1920s & is a prequel to The Shadow of the Wind. David Martin is a young man working in a newspaper office. But late one night the editor of the paper has a crisis
- they have just had to drop six pages from the weekend edition & he has a matter of hours to fill them. With most of the staff already home, he turns to David & asks if he can write a short story. If it is good, he will publish more. The resulting story is a huge success & is David's first step on the path to a career as an author. As David's books gain a certain recognition, he receives a mysterious letter from a French editor called Andreas Corelli who wants to help him achieve his ambitions. But the character is not all that he seems & soon David has entered a pact that will lead him question everything he values. He is also befriended by the bookseller Sempere (the grandfather of Daniel from Shadow) who introduces him to the strange world of the Cemetery of Forgotten Books. The Angel's Game is a tale of lost souls & literary intrigue; a book steeped in the world of writing, with references to Dr Jekyll & Mr Hyde & Great Expectations. It is about the demons a writer faces; but also a page-turning mystery & a love story set against the creaking mansions & mysterious alleyways at the dark heart of Barcelona.
